
The Box Shop June 16 Food Market backed by American Express

Vilakazi Street will be abuzz as food and art lovers alike, artisans and entrepreneurs descend upon the annual Box Shop June 16 Food Market on Youth Day. With the powerful backing by American Express, The Box Shop June 16 Food Market will be celebrating its second year of the partnership.

The food market will feature 22 stalls operated by young entrepreneurs. Out of the 22 stalls, 12 will be dedicated to food from African-inspired traditional cuisines, hot authentic beverages, a display and showcase of local wines and ready to eat products. The remaining 10 stalls will be dedicated to fashion, accessories and jewellery products.
American Express will set up all 22 suppliers with pocket point-of-sale (POS) devices at no cost to enable the youth-owned SMEs to transact with ease.
The Box Shop is sure to be the flavour of the day, with a full line-up of activities, live music, performances and art installations. Under the theme, Uprising, this year’s event is set to recognise and celebrate “youth heroes who were remembered but never celebrated,” says Sifiso Moyo, co-founder of The Box Shop.
The establishment will be partnering with Mbuyisa Makhubo’s family and the June 16 Foundation to commemorate Mbuyisa Makhubu’s display of heroism and bravery on that fateful day when he carried 13-year-old Hector Peterson who had been shot by police.
The day will be dedicated to the fallen heroes of June 16 with a Hero’s Walk followed by the unveiling of never seen before Mbuyisa Makhubo archived images and apparel, to preserve his memory. Also, on the day’s line up is a knowledge sharing panel discussion seeking to upskill young entrepreneurs on the reality of being an entrepreneur in South Africa.

Vilakazi Street will transform into an epitome of youth culture, showcasing the entrepreneurial and creative spirit of a youth that is continuously on the rise.
The 2019 Box Shop June 16 Food Market will be open from 08h00 – 24h00 and entrance is free.

About Box Shop
The Box Shop SA is a lifestyle and retail initiative founded with a primary objective of solving access to market problems faced by small to medium enterprises in the textile, accessories, cosmetics, furniture and crafts industries. The Box Shop SA offers a platform for young entrepreneurs to grow their businesses by reaching markets beyond their social influence and eventually positioning themselves in global markets.
